In 1996, with a dream of bringing quality affordable dance and performance classes to her local community in Dagenham, Maria opened up Donovans Stage School. A few months later and her sister Michelle joined Maria running courses for children and young adults within Dagenham in Modern, Tap, Lyrical and Ballet. In the time from 1996-2012 in which they were principals of the school, both Maria and Michelle achieved great success.
They put students through examinations, gaining a 100% pass rate; they also had major success at dance competitions. Students have performed in some incredible venues such as Disneyland Paris, London Pallidum, Her Majesty Theatre and The 02. In 1999, Donovans took part in a Guinness World Record challenge along with other dances school under Mardi Gras Events. Maria and Michelle had the privilege of training students and giving them memories to last a lifetime.
In 2012, Maria and Michelle decided to pass the school down to their daughter/niece, Sarah. Sarah has completed her degree in Musical Theatre and trained at Italia Conti Academy of Theatre Arts was more than keen to continue on the success of the school which growing up became her family and make it even more significant. Sarah added further opportunities for the students, offering a wide variety of subjects from Acting and Musical Theatre to Street and Contemporary, we’re lucky to have the expertise to provide it with all.
